What Exactly is the Goethe-Zertifikat B2?
The Goethe-Zertifikat B2 is the 4th level credentials in the six-level scale of competence specified by the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). This framework, globally recognized, sets the standard for explaining language capability. At the B2 level, a language student is considered to have reached Vantage level, representing a capability to understand the main points of complex texts on both concrete and abstract subjects, consisting of technical discussions in their field of expertise. They can likewise interact with a degree of fluency and spontaneity that makes routine interaction with native speakers quite possible without stress for either party. Moreover, B2 level speakers can produce clear, comprehensive text on a vast array of topics and describe a perspective on a topical concern offering the advantages and disadvantages of various alternatives.
In essence, the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 accredits that you possess a strong intermediate to upper-intermediate level of German, enabling you to navigate a wide variety of scenarios in German-speaking environments efficiently. It's a testimony to your capability to use the language not just in easy, daily circumstances, however also in more complex and nuanced contexts.
Deconstructing the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 Exam:
The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am is developed to examine your German language efficiency across four crucial ability areas, matching real-life language usage: Reading, Writing, Listening, and Speaking. Each module is individually examined, making sure a holistic assessment of your language proficiencies. Let's break down each area:
Reading (Lesen): This module evaluates your ability to comprehend different types of written German. You will come across texts such as short articles, reports, commentaries, and ads. The tasks typically include:
Global Understanding: Identifying the essence or general subject of a text.Detailed Understanding: Comprehending specific information, viewpoints, goethezertifikat and arguments within a text.Selective Understanding: Locating specific information needed to answer a question.Lexical and Grammatical Understanding: Understanding vocabulary and grammatical structures in context.
This section usually makes up multiple-choice concerns, matching jobs, and gap-fill workouts and lasts around 65 minutes.
Writing (Schreiben): This module assesses your ability to produce clear, meaningful, and efficient written German. You will be asked to complete two tasks:
Task 1: Writing an official or semi-formal letter or email based upon a provided timely. This could involve revealing opinions, making demands, or reporting on events.Task 2: Writing a longer piece of text, such as an essay, commentary, or report, on a provided subject. This requires you to present arguments, reveal opinions, and structure your thoughts rationally.
The writing module is designed to evaluate your grammar, vocabulary, coherence, and capability to address the timely successfully and lasts around 75 minutes.
Listening (Hören): This section examines your capability to comprehend spoken German in different contexts. You will listen to various audio recordings, such as discussions, interviews, statements, and radio broadcasts. Jobs might include:
Global Understanding: Identifying the primary topic of a recording.In-depth Understanding: Answering specific questions about information presented in the audio.Selective Understanding: Extracting specific information from the recording.
The listening module uses multiple-choice concerns, true/false statements, and gap-fill workouts and lasts approximately 40 minutes.
Speaking (Sprechen): This module evaluates your ability to interact efficiently in spoken German in different interactive scenarios. It is normally conducted as a paired or specific exam and is divided into three parts:
Part 1: Getting to know each other (Kontakte knüpfen): A brief initial conversation with the examiner or partner, involving exchanging individual info and engaging in casual conversation.Part 2: Presentation (Präsentation): You will be asked to present a brief discussion on a given topic, revealing your viewpoint and elaborating on your perspective.Part 3: Discussion (Diskussion): You will engage in a discussion with the examiner or your partner about a provided topic, revealing viewpoints, concurring or disagreeing, and proposing services.
The speaking module is created to evaluate your fluency, pronunciation, vocabulary, grammar, and interactive interaction abilities and lasts around 15 minutes (for a paired exam, it's about 20 minutes).

Often Asked Questions (FAQs) about the Goethe-Zertifikat B2
Q: What level is the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 in the CEFR?A: The Goethe-Zertifikat B2 represents the B2 level (Vantage level) in the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R).
Q: Is the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 recognized worldwide?A: Yes, the Goethe-a1 zertifikat kaufen erfahrungen B2 is worldwide acknowledged by companies, universities, and federal government firms worldwide as evidence of intermediate to upper-intermediate German language abilities.
Q: How long is the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 valid?A: The Goethe-Zertifikat B2, like other Goethe-Institut language certificates, does not have an expiration date. It remains a permanent record of your language proficiency.
Q: How do I register for the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am?A: You can register for the exam at a licensed Goethe-Institut exam center. Find a center near you on the Goethe-Institut site and examine their registration procedures and due dates.
Q: What takes place if I fail a module in the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am?A: To pass the Goethe-Zertifikat B2, you need to pass all four modules (Reading, Writing, Listening, and Speaking). If you stop working several modules, you typically need to retake only the stopped working modules, not the entire exam. Inspect the particular policies of your exam center.
Q: Are there any prerequisites for taking the B2 exam?A: There are no official requirements for taking the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am. However, it is advised to have actually reached a solid B1 level of German before trying the B2 exam. The Goethe-Institut suggests around 600-750 hours of German lessons prior to taking the B2 exam, but this is simply a guideline.
Q: How much does the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am cost?A: The exam charge varies depending upon the exam center and area. Inspect the site of your chosen Goethe-Institut exam center for the existing fee.
Q: How long does it require to get the outcomes of the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am?A: The time it requires to receive your outcomes can differ, however it is normally around 4-6 weeks after the exam date. Contact your exam center for specific information relating to result release dates.
Q: Can I prepare for the B2 exam on my own?A: Yes, it is possible to get ready for the B2 exam individually utilizing textbooks, online resources, and practice products. Nevertheless, registering in a Goethe-Institut preparation course or working with a tutor can provide structured assistance and important feedback, possibly enhancing your preparation and chances of success.
